The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Cuenca–Fernando Zóbel to Madrid Chamartín is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id traveling at rush hour.
The average ticket from Cuenca–Fernando Zóbel to Madrid Chamartín will cost around $50 if you buy it on the day, but the cheapest tickets can be found for only $19.
On Sat, Sep 19, we found 17 trains from Cuenca–Fernando Zóbel to Madrid Chamartín, including 17 direct services.
On Sat, Sep 19 the direct trains cover the 139 km distance in an average of 1 h 3 m but if you time it right, some trains will get you there in just 1 h 2 m .

Overview: Train from Cuenca–Fernando Zóbel to Madrid Chamartín
Trains from Cuenca–Fernando Zóbel to Madrid Chamartín run on average 17 times per day, taking around 1h 5m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$9 if you book in advance.
There are 17 trains per day. The earliest train runs at 05:07, the last at 20:45. The fastest train covers the 86 miles (139 km) distance in 1h 2m.

Getting to Cuenca Fernando Zóbel from Cuenca city centre
Cuenca Fernando Zóbel is 3 km from Cuenca city centre. Public transport options include:
Cuenca Fernando Zóbel train station facilities and services
Cuenca Fernando Zóbel has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Parking,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Lost and Found Office,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Information Desk, and Luggage Carts.
